Optimizing the Core: Confronting Environmental Hurdles in Pigment production

The heart of the environmental obstacle from the pigment industry lies within the producing procedure alone. historically, the synthesis of advanced organic pigments has actually been an Electrical power-intensive and chemically demanding endeavor. A Major worry is the extensive use of natural and organic solvents, that are typically important to facilitate chemical reactions and accomplish the desired crystal composition from the pigment. a lot of of these conventional solvents are risky organic and natural compounds (VOCs), which can escape into your environment throughout creation, heating, and drying levels. VOCs are A significant contributor to air pollution, leading to the formation of ground-degree ozone and posing wellbeing threats to industrial workers and nearby communities. Also, the synthesis of high-general performance pigments often involves reactions at significant temperatures and pressures, accompanied by Electricity-intensive drying and milling procedures. This significant Power consumption interprets straight to a considerable carbon footprint, inserting a large load on our planet's climate.

In response, the market is going through a profound transformation toward greener production protocols. Leading manufacturers are actively phasing out hazardous solvents in favor of environmentally friendly options, which include ionic liquids or supercritical fluids, that have a A lot reduced environmental impact. Where common solvents remain important, the implementation of Superior closed-loop Restoration programs is becoming standard follow. These methods capture and condense solvent vapors, allowing them to get purified and reused, dramatically lowering VOC emissions and operational expenditures. within the Electricity front, innovation is centered on system optimization and heat recovery. contemporary reactors are suitable for better thermal performance, and reducing-edge warmth exchangers are being mounted to seize squander heat from higher-temperature processes and redirect it to other plant functions, including pre-heating Uncooked supplies or drying completed products. These strategic optimizations are certainly not almost compliance; they represent a essential change towards lean, successful, and low-affect producing.

The 3-Pronged squander dilemma: taking care of Effluents, Emissions, and Solid Residues

past the Main producing course of action, the administration of squander streams—liquid, gaseous, and strong—offers An additional major hurdle. Pigment output invariably generates sophisticated wastewater characterised by high color depth, chemical oxygen demand from customers (COD), and infrequently significant salinity. Discharging this effluent with no substantial treatment method would induce serious ecological harm to aquatic ecosystems. Gaseous emissions are An additional worry; over and above VOCs, certain chemical reactions can launch nitrogen oxides (NOx), sulfur oxides (SOx), or malodorous compounds that contribute to acid rain and air high quality degradation. ultimately, the method generates strong squander, which include expended filter media, residual sludge from wastewater therapy, and off-spec product or service. Disposing of the good waste in landfills is don't just unsustainable and also represents a loss of likely resources.

To tackle this tripartite obstacle, a comprehensive and integrated approach to squander management is crucial. A state-of-the-art perylene pigment manufacturing unit right now operates a lot more similar to a source reclamation facility than a standard chemical plant. Wastewater undergoes a multi-phase procedure system that starts with Bodily and chemical pre-treatment to get rid of colour and suspended solids. This is often followed by Superior Organic treatment method, like membrane bioreactors (MBR), which use microorganisms to break down advanced natural compounds. For significantly stubborn pollutants, Advanced Oxidation Processes (AOPs) are deployed as a ultimate polishing action to ensure the water is Harmless for discharge. For air emissions, regenerative thermal oxidizers (RTOs) are accustomed to wipe out harmful gases at higher effectiveness. most of all, the marketplace is embracing a round financial state mindset for sound waste. as an alternative to remaining landfilled, materials like filter cake and specific sorts of sludge are analyzed for his or her likely reuse. Some are repurposed as inert fillers in building resources like bricks or cement, turning a squander liability right into a useful secondary Uncooked materials and shutting the loop with a at the time-linear system.

The merchandise as the answer: Elevating Eco-efficiency and Regulatory Compliance

The thrust for sustainability extends much beyond the manufacturing facility gates and into the pretty DNA of your pigment itself. in the present world current market, governed by stringent laws like Europe's attain (Registration, Evaluation, Authorisation and Restriction of chemical compounds) and RoHS (Restriction of harmful Substances), a pigment is judged not simply on its shade but on its environmental and wellness profile. The focus has shifted to generating pigments with very low toxicity, small major metallic content material, and low migration properties, making sure They are really Safe and sound for use in delicate apps like toys (EN-seventy one standard), food items packaging, and customer electronics.

This is where substantial-effectiveness pigments, like those within the perylene pigment family, genuinely glow as a sustainable Alternative. solutions like Perylene Black 32 are engineered for Extraordinary toughness. Their excellent light fastness usually means they resist fading even less than extended exposure to sunlight. Their substantial thermal security permits them to withstand the acute temperatures of plastic extrusion and superior-bake automotive coatings with no degradation. This unbelievable resilience is a robust type of indirect environmentalism. whenever a coating, plastic, or fiber retains its coloration and integrity for for a longer time, the lifespan of the tip-products is extended. This minimizes the need for substitution, which in turn conserves the raw products, Strength, and water that will have already been consumed in producing a brand new merchandise. By coming up with for longevity, pigment brands lead on to decreasing use and waste era throughout a number of downstream industries.

the subsequent Frontier: Innovation and R&D because the motor for Eco-Breakthroughs

While latest systems have designed immense strides, the long-phrase vision for a truly sustainable pigment field is being cast in analysis and development labs. another wave of innovation aims to fundamentally redesign pigment synthesis from the ground up, going faraway from a reliance on fossil fuels and severe chemical procedures. scientists are Checking out novel synthetic pathways that leverage biotechnology, like using enzymes as catalysts (biocatalysis) to conduct reactions at reduced temperatures and with larger specificity, thus lessening energy consumption and by-product or service development.

One more crucial spot of R&D is the development of pigments from renewable, non-petroleum-based mostly feedstocks. This bio-dependent technique seeks to decouple pigment output in the volatile and environmentally taxing petrochemical business. Moreover, as industries like coatings and printing inks continue on to shift clear of solvent-dependent programs, There exists immense give attention to acquiring pigments and dispersion technologies optimized for waterborne methods. generating steady, large-effectiveness aqueous dispersions of pigments like Perylene Black is usually a vital R&D purpose, mainly because it straight permits the formulation of eco-helpful, minimal-VOC paints, inks, and coatings that will define the marketplace of the future. This relentless pursuit of innovation ensures that the field is not merely reacting to latest rules but actively shaping a more sustainable tomorrow.
